Handover note — Crumbwheel order cutoffs.

Welcome aboard. The bakery cutoff rule in Crumbwheel closes same-day orders at 14:00 local to each storefront, not UTC — this has bitten us twice. Holiday overrides live in the calendar service and take precedence silently, so always check there first when a cutoff looks wrong. To unlock the calendar service's admin console after a restart, enter the recovery passphrase below.

vault phrase of bagap-bahaf = silion-pelox-sorox-casdor-quenwyn-fraax-eliox-praael-kelion-quenvan-kasox-rusael-norius-belvan

// TUNING NOTE for reviewers: this constant caps per-message deflate on the
// Skarn websocket gateway. Compression above level 6 saved under 3% bandwidth
// in the Holloway bench runs but doubled CPU on small frames, so we pin level 4.
// Revisit only with fresh benchmarks. The benchmark build reference follows below.

pipeline stamp: htk3_cc5

Ticket: Config drift on the Harrowfield Arena turnstile counter. Prod nodes in the east concourse are running last month's gate-debounce and sync-interval values while the west concourse picked up the new release. Counts diverge by roughly 2% during peak ingress, which broke tonight's occupancy report. Requesting a hold on the Saturday release until all nodes are reconciled. Drift likely came from a manual hotfix applied during the Kestrel Cup. The expected values, pulled from the release manifest, are listed below.

deployment values, kajep-kageg:
[praix]
host = praix.paliqcorp.corp
user = praix_svc
database = praix_prod